Twelve starting QBs have suffered more sacks then Kizer's 11. And we know he has taken more than was necessary. Proof? Kizer ranks 2nd in NextGen Stats' "time to throw" clocking in at 3.04 seconds. Whose #1? The new darling around here... Deshaun Watson at 3.11. https://nextgenstats.nfl.com/stats/passing#average-time-to-throw Then there's the sack trend for Weeks 1 thru 4... 7 - 2 - 1 - 1. To quote Sesame Street.... "One of these things is not like the others." https://www.pro-football-reference.com/players/K/KizeDe00/gamelog/2017/ Run game? Touched on this a couple days ago. Out of the ShotGun we are primarily running ZBS. Crow is not a ZBS back. Don't have stats on this. Just working off casual observation and general formation tendencies. The OL is better.
